Hydrangea paniculata 'Limelight'
Towering, pointed spikes of flat, white flowers open pale green and later become tinged with pink. The blooms cover a bush of mid-green leaves. A very handsome plant.

Colour: White
Flowers: Summer
Height x Spread: 200cm x 200cm
Soil: Well-drained
Planting position: Sun/Partial Shade
Hardy to -10 degrees and more, the foliage drops off in autumn and grows again in spring. If the plant needs shaping prune in spring before new shoots emerge. Cut off the old flower heads to tidy the plant.
